Vibration Isolators – Reduction of vibrations and noise in machines and equipment
The DVA.3-30-40-M8-55 vibration isolator is an element dedicated to damping vibrations and reducing noise generated by operating machines and equipment. Its use translates to improved work comfort, increased safety, and extended equipment life. The construction based on a flexible material, namely rubber with a hardness of 55 Shore’a, allows for effective absorption of vibration energy, minimizing its transfer to the environment or the equipment structure.
Construction and application
The DVA.3 vibration isolator is characterized by a cylindrical construction and has internal M8 threads on both sides. This allows for easy mounting between structural elements, ensuring a stable connection and effective isolation. Steel, galvanized inserts increase strength and corrosion resistance, which is particularly important in demanding industrial conditions. This specific model, with a diameter of 30 mm and a height of 40 mm, is used for mounting components such as motors, fans, or pumps. Thanks to its construction, it also works well in isolating electrical cabinets or other elements sensitive to vibrations.
Key features and benefits
- Effective vibration reduction: Rubber with a hardness of 55 Shore’a provides optimal vibration damping over a wide frequency range.
- Durable construction: Galvanized steel inserts guarantee high resistance to mechanical loads and corrosion.
- Easy installation: Internal M8 threads on both sides allow for quick and secure mounting.
- Versatile application: Ideal for mounting machine components, isolating electrical cabinets, and reducing noise in various industrial applications.
- Improved work comfort: Reducing the level of vibration translates to better working conditions for the operator.
- Extended service life: Damping vibrations reduces mechanical loads on structural elements, which contributes to their longer use.
Choosing the right vibration isolator is crucial for achieving optimal results. Parameters such as vibration frequency, load, and the required degree of damping should be considered.
